>> This test is failing often since 8304725 added a call to 
>> Thread::current_in_asgct().  This can end up being called e.g. when 
>> resolving calls, and then the OS last error value is lost.
>> 
>> The test is reliable with a single warm-up call to getLastError.invoke() 
>> before the loop.
>> 
>> The test was introduced when in JDK-8292302 a change was undone that had 
>> made JavaThread::threadObj call Thread::current_or_null_safe, as the use of 
>> TLS upset this case of accessing last error directly.
>> 
>> This new Thread::current_in_asgct() case shows that the VM will find new 
>> ways to interfere with the last error value, or at least new VM code keeps 
>> wanting to call Thread::current.  This testcase is kind of niche usage, so 
>> it not an argument that VM code should not be calling Thread::current.   If 
>> this test is to stay active, it needs to have this warm-up getLastError 
>> call.  (If there are more issues, it might mean removing the test.)
